Phillips 66 T5X Off-Road Mobile Hydraulic 10W

Phillips 66 T5X Off-Road Mobile Hydraulic 10W is a high-performance hydraulic fluid designed primarily for use in the hydraulic systems of Caterpillar and other off-highway mobile equipment. It also may be used in the hydrostatic transmissions of some off-road equipment. It is formulated to provide excellent wear protection, to protect hydraulic system components against rust and corrosion, and to resist foaming. 

It has excellent oxidation resistance to minimize deposit formation and provide long service life, and high dispersancy-detergency to maintain hydraulic system cleanliness. It contains a high level of zinc-containing anti-wear additive to meet Caterpillar requirements for use in the hydraulic systems of Caterpillar equipment. It has a high viscosity index for use over a wide temperature range. Phillips 66 T5X Off-Road Mobile Hydraulic, 10W, 55 gallon drum also provides the following benefits: 

  • High viscosity index for use over a wide temperature range 
  • Excellent wear protection for hydraulic system components 
  • High dispersancy-detergency for excellent system cleanliness 
  • Protects against deposit formation 
  • Protects against rust and corrosion 
  • Good resistance to foaming 

Applications 

  • Hydraulic systems and some hydrostatic transmissions on Caterpillar and other off-highway mobile equipment 
  • Hydraulic systems operating over a wide temperature range
